Roles and Responsibilities
The Research & Development department focuses on the design, characterization, and optimization of biologic molecules and platforms to support preclinical and clinical development. The team works across multiple modalities including monoclonal antibodies, multispecifics, and complex biologics.
In this internship for life science students, you will support lab-based research including sterile mammalian cell culture, cell counting, metabolite screening, transfection, media preparation, and analytical techniques such as ddPCR and SDS-PAGE. Youโll work cross-functionally with Cell Line Development, Molecular Biology, and Process Development teams to advance processes and capabilities that improve cell lines and accelerate development timelines. This role offers exposure to experimental design, data analysis, and scientific documentation, providing a strong foundation in early-stage biologics development.
